Output 8328f890c6052569a6374c579ba15911bd75691d8829b93f2119d8dbfe85c561:0

value
76005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d4727c50f768f20a7c9263ff7e0399845759bd OP_EQUAL
address
3FMF7DZWJ4Zw5GM4qfoTfpBHzBwKcMJeRS
transaction
8328f890c6052569a6374c579ba15911bd75691d8829b93f2119d8dbfe85c561
spent
false

1 Sat Range